How to prevent fabric abrasion from wind-blown debris in outdoor tree boxes?
Fabric abrasion in outdoor tree boxes is a common issue caused by wind-blown debris like leaves, twigs, and dust. Over time, this can weaken the fabric, leading to tears and reduced durability. Here are some practical solutions to protect your tree box fabrics:
1. Use Protective Covers: Invest in durable, weather-resistant covers designed to shield the fabric from debris. These covers can be easily removed and cleaned.
2. Install Wind Barriers: Place small fences or mesh screens around the tree boxes to block direct contact with wind-blown debris.
3. Choose Abrasion-Resistant Fabrics: Opt for high-quality, tightly woven fabrics that are less prone to abrasion. Materials like polyester or coated canvas are excellent choices.
4. Regular Maintenance: Clean the fabric and surrounding area frequently to remove accumulated debris, preventing long-term damage.
5. Apply Fabric Protectors: Use commercial fabric protectors or sprays to add an extra layer of resistance against abrasion and UV rays.
By implementing these strategies, you can significantly extend the lifespan of your outdoor tree box fabrics and maintain their aesthetic appeal.
